Prerequisite (s): Stealth proficiency, Sneak Attack class ability. WebJan 22, 2024 · Sneak Attack is the iconic damage feature for the Rogue class in D&D 5e. It requires a ranged or finesse weapon. Sneak Attack also requires the Rogue to either have Advantage or an enemy of your target to be within 5 feet of it. A successful Sneak Attack does an extra 1d6 points of damage.

WebJan 22, 2024 · In DnD 5e, flanking is an optional rule meant to represent the combat advantage you gain when you and your allies attack an enemy from multiple directions. WebMay 18, 2012 · Sorted by: 8. Yes. The grabbed DDI condition doesn't prevent you from attacking the grabber, so you can flank it if your ally is in the right position. Grabbed. While a creature is grabbed, it is immobilized. Maintaining this condition on the creature occupies whatever appendage, object, or effect the grabber used to initiate the grab. It’s essentially an optional rule for teaming up on a surrounded enemy, giving you advantage to attack the creature you’ve encircled or boxed in.
